Since it was officially recognized by the United Nations in 1993, International Day for the Eradication of Poverty has been observed every year on Oct 17.
It is intended to promote awareness of the need to eradicate the poverty caused by sanctions, war, disasters, discrimination and wealth centralization, particularly in developing countries.
At the UN Millennium Summit, world leaders adopted the Millennium Declaration, comprising eight goals, of which the eradication of extreme poverty and hunger was the first priority. They committed themselves to halving the proportion of the world's people whose income is less than $1 a day by the year 2015.
